点、直线与圆的位置关系演示
2013-10-20 13:08
本GeoGebra范例直观展示了点、直线与圆之间的基本几何位置关系。通过构造圆、直线、线段及交点,动态演示了点与圆的相对位置(圆内、圆上、圆外)以及直线与圆的相交、相切和相离状态。适用于平面几何教学,帮助学生深入理解圆的基本性质及相关几何定理。
